75g flour
25g oats
50g unsweetened applesauce
420g peaches
1/2 tsp baking powder
about half a cup almond milk
cinnamon
splenda
Vanilla Maple Arctic Zero on top
This was almost fat free. Just trace amounts of fat from the oats and almond milk. This was my first attempt. It would be nice to have the crumbly top but I think that requires butter/brown sugar. I cooked the peaches stove top with splenda/cinnamon till they softened up and almost kind of caramalized. Mixed all other ingredients in a separate bowl. Sprayed an oven safe pan with pam. Layed out about 3/4 of the peaches, poured the batter over, then put remaining peaches on top. Baked at 350 for about 18 or so mins.556/325/622 - 1504 total raw @ 193
